Chapter 1 Using the Linksys Voice System
The Linksys Voice System
Figure 1-1 The Linksys Voice System (LVS) with the SPA9000 and SPA400
The LVS 9000 system uses the power of VoIP to provide enterprise-quality telephony features to small
office/home office (SOHO) and small businesses. The LVS is based on open standards, such as SIP,. This
allows interoperation with other standards-based products and simplifies configuration and use. The
SPA9000, with a base license, supports up to four IP phones and up to 16 phones with an upgraded
license.
With the optional SPA400, the SPA9000 can also manage calls to and from the PSTN. The SPA9000 also
includes an Analog Telephone Adapter (ATA), with two FXS ports for connecting analog telephones, fax
devices, or an external music source for the music on-hold service included with the SPA9000.
The SPA9000 supports four independent line interfaces with numbers assigned by one to four different
ITSPs, with each line supporting up to 16 extensions. If the service provider supplies a group of
sequential direct inward dial (DID) phone numbers (such as 408-777-1000 through 777-1015) the
SPA9000 can support all the assigned numbers on a single line interface.

SPA400 SIP-PSTN Gateway and Voicemail
The SPA400 is optionally used with the SPA9000 to provide a SIP-PSTN gateway, providing voice
connectivity between the PSTN and local client stations connected to the SPA9000. It also provides a
local voicemail server.
Note The SPA400 provides four FXO ports and occupies one line interface on the SPA9000.
A total of four SPA400 devices can be configured per SPA9000, using up to 16 analog phone lines and,
with the SPA9000, automatically routing calls to and from your existing PSTN telephone service.
